Size

Sofas are the centerpiece of many living spaces that provide seating for friends and family. They are available in a variety of styles, making them the perfect choice for any space. Whether you are seeking a modern leather couch or a cozy fabric couch, there's certain to be a sofa that matches your style and budget. However, when looking for a sofa, it is important to consider the size of your living space prior to making a purchase. A sofa that is too large for a room can make it feel crowded and cramped. To avoid this, take a measurement of the dimensions of your space and use painter's tape to outline the space where you intend to place your couch. Compare these dimensions with the sofa dimensions and ensure that it fits in your space. When measuring, you should be aware of the ceiling's height and the space where furniture is placed.

The seat height is an important consideration when you are looking for a sofa. A lower height seat is ideal for smaller spaces, and it could help to create a more spacious feeling in the room. A smaller sofa is easier to move down the hallway and through doors.

When you are looking for a sofa, it's important to consider the quality of the frame. You should ensure that the frame is constructed from durable materials and the joints are securely fastened. Additionally, the padding should be thick and durable. Examine the upholstery and suspension of the sofa. The suspension should be made of serpentine or coiled springs, while the upholstery should also be of good quality.

Fabric

The fabric you select for your sofa is among the key factors that determines the overall appearance and feel. Some fabrics are more durable, comfortable and easy to take care of than others. A good sofa will last longer than a less expensive one, which can wear out quickly and require frequent replacements. A quality sofa will retain its shape and color throughout the years and is a great investment for your home.

The sofa's material must match with the rest of the room's decor and suit your personal style. It must be comfortable and not fade or stain easily. Certain sofas come with removable covers that make it easier to clean and maintain the fabric. High-quality grey sofas for sale can also be reupholstered if needed.

When selecting a sofa, you must consider how often it will be utilized and where. If you have pets and young children, you may prefer a material that is easy to clean. Budget

Sofas can be expensive, but they're worth the investment in comfort and style. Set a budget prior to shopping so that you don't get overwhelmed by the choices. When determining your budget, consider the size and shape of the sofa you want and any other features you're interested in. For instance, do you want a power footrest, massage functions, or reclining? These options will add to the price.

Fabric is another aspect to think about. You'll want a sofa that is easy to clean and sturdy if you have children or pets. Leather and microfibers are both good options, since they stand up well to everyday wear and tear. Textured fabrics can also hide stains better than smooth fabrics, and they are an excellent option for areas that see lots of use.

The frame and fill of the sofa also contribute to its longevity. Find a sofa that has a solid wood frame and high-quality fill, which lasts longer than sofas constructed of particleboard or plywood. Also, be sure to determine whether the sofa comes with springs. If it does, it must have hand-tied eight-way springs, which are the best for comfort and support.
